1. According to Liston's police record, he was born in 1928, which would make him 5 years older, than his 'Ring Age'
2. He was arrested 19 times and went to prison for violence related crimes..
3. Throughout the 5 years he served at Jefferson Penetantary, he wasn't allowed to speak, due to a strict code of silence that had been enforced by the prison governors.. Liston said of his time behind bars, "I didn't mind prison to much, it was the 1st time i ever got 3 meals a day?"
4. J. Edgar Hoover, the then director of the FBI, had his own special file on Liston..
5. Before fighting Liston, in his last fight as champ, Floyd Patterson was summoned to the White House and urged by John F Kennedy, to "make sure you beat him, as the reputation of our country depends on it."
6. After resting the title from Patterson, an elated Liston immediately prepared a speech for the airport reception..
Well known writer, Jack McKinney, who was travelling from Chicago with him at the time, recalled; "in it, it said, I now a lot of my own people have been against me, but i want to proove to them that i'm not gonna embarrass them, i'll make them proud."
He then went on to say, "On arriving in Philadelphia, Sonny took a step outside and stood there for a moment, just looking.. I could see him looking both ways.. Nothing. Noboby was there.. I could almost see the air go out of him.. The big broad shoulders infront of me just seemed to sag."
7. In 1963, Liston was sued by an ex-bodyguard for allegedly raping his wife..
Rumour has it, that the mob were involved in hushing this up..
8. Cleveland Williams's wife, Irene, once danced with Liston, and described him as 'the perfect gentleman, and a nice person, who just wanted to be accepted by society." This was despite him knocking her husband out on 2 occasions..
9. Shortly after becoming champ, Liston enrolled with the local church, originally to avoid Police harassment, but grew to like it, doing a lot for charity, and showing his softer side, especially with children who he adored.
The church priest, Father Murphy, became one of Sonny's closest friends..
10. I wouldn't know why, but Sonny and his wife Geraldine, couldn't have children of their own, and adopted a baby boy who they named Davey..
Liston was a very proud father and absolutely doted on the child..
11. Minutes before Liston's 1964 rematch with Ali, the retired Joe Louis went to Sonny's dressing room to wish him luck..
"Joe, I don't feel so good," grumbled Liston..
"Whadaya mean?" asked Louis..
Liston's head was on his massive chest, before he finally looked up and mumbled to Louis, "Just aint right, Joe."
Sonny's concerned wife, had already pleaded with him to, "Go down, rather than risk serious injury."
12. Sonny could always revert to type.. Shortly before the assassination of JFK, Liston and his publicity man, Ben Bentley were invited to Washington to meet vice-president Lyndon Johnson.. As Johnson talked compulsively while showing them around his luxury office appartment, Liston looked at Bentley and whispered, "Whadaya say we blow this bum off?"
